應用人因工程技術改善油墨工廠之工作場所

Application of Ergonomic Technique to Improve The Workplaces of An Ink Factory

指導教授 : 游志雲
若您是本文的作者,可授權文章由華藝線上圖書館中協助推廣。

摘要


本文目的在於應用人因工程技術改善油墨工廠之工作場所。國內外勞工因為工作所引起的職業性肌肉骨骼傷害問題日益趨於嚴重。肌肉骨骼傷害案件佔所有職業傷害的比例,我國與歐美日各國平均都在30%以上,肌肉骨骼傷害不僅會危害勞工的身體健康,降低生產力,進而也會影響到產業整體的競爭力。造成肌肉骨骼傷害的五大成因為不良的姿勢、過度施力、高重覆動作、衝擊震動、高低溫。這五項成因之中,「不良姿勢」會與其他四項成因產生加乘作用,使得肌肉骨骼的負荷急遽升高,所以「不良姿勢」是造成肌肉骨骼傷害的催化元兇。因此要降低肌肉骨骼的傷害,首先要改善工作姿勢:根據人因工程的概念,以機能工作姿勢的觀點,讓勞工採行比較「自然」而且「省力」的工作姿勢。 本研究應用人因工程技術,針對國內一家油墨工廠中的色相比對、1公斤油墨裝罐、油墨上料、16公斤油墨裝罐、松香水裝罐等五項作業進行改善。改善流程是先透過現場訪視來了解作業現況與流程,接著由作業找出造成肌肉骨骼傷害成因的線索,再使用OWAS工作姿勢分析方法來加以證實,再以機能工作姿勢的觀點進行改善,最後同樣以OWAS工作姿勢分析方法對改善方案進行效益評估,看肌肉骨骼傷害是否真的有降低或消除。評估結果顯示,這五項作業經由人因工程技術改善之後,人員在工作姿勢與作業環境原本存在的危害成因,均有顯著的降低與消除,將肌肉骨骼傷害大幅降低。 關鍵字:機能工作姿勢、肌肉骨骼傷害、人因工程技術、OWAS

並列摘要


The object of this study is to use ergonomics technique to improve the workplace design of an ink factory. Work-related musculoskeletal disorder (WMSD) is becoming increasingly serious in industrial countries as well as in Taiwan. The proportion of WMSD cases among all occupational injury is generally above 30%. WMSD affects not only worker’s health, but also lowers productivity and reduce the competitiveness of a country. It is generally agreed that the major causes of WMSD are poor posture, over-exertion, high-repetitiveness, shock and vibration, high and low temperature. Among these five causes, bad posture will interact and significantly elevate the musculoskeletal stress due to others causes, such as over-exertion. It is regarded as the root cause among them. To reduce WMSD, poor posture should be improved in the first place. Ergonomics principle suggests that functional working posture should be adopted during work, for it is the most nature and energy-saving posture under the requirement of task performance. In this study, ergonomics technique is used to improve five workplaces in an ink factory. These five workplaces are color comparison, 1 kg-ink-can packaging, ink feeding, 16 kg-ink-can packaging, thinner can packaging operations. The process of improvement begin with on-site observation of current work situation and task process, followed by identification the causes of WMSD with OWAS checklist, then improve workplace design based on functional posture, finally evaluate the effectiveness of improvement also with the same OWAS checklist. The results of evaluation show that musculoskeletal stress has been substantially lowered after improvement, and WMSD can be reduced. This study has demonstrated a simple and effective method on prevention of WMSD, it can be promoted. Keywords:Functional working posture, Work-Related Musculoskeletal disorders, Ergonomic technique, OWAS
